## Fan-out Backpressure

When Quillstone's notification fan-out saturates, the broker sheds low-priority pushes first; support will see delayed digests before anything user-visible breaks. Escalate only if the drop ratio exceeds the posted threshold for ten minutes. Most tickets resolve once the queue drains. The current limits governing shedding and drain behavior are as follows.

constants for yajog-tajep:
QUOTAS = {
    "fenir": 536,
    "normir": 443,
    "fenath": 793,
}

Subject: Quickstore 4.2 — bloom filter now fronts the KV layer

Plugin authors: starting with this release, Quickstore places a bloom filter ahead of the key-value store. Negative lookups return faster; false positives fall through safely. No API changes are required on your side. Verify your plugin against the staging build referenced below.

session token of fahif-tadup = htk3_9c7

☐ **Step 7 — Unlock the encoder signing key.** Welcome to your first key ceremony for the Renderhive transcoding farm! Once the two witnesses from the Opsbridge team confirm the node inventory matches the manifest, you'll unseal the hardware token at the Calverton rack. Don't rush this — the farm can't sign new encode jobs until it's done. When the token prompts you, type the recovery passphrase exactly as written here:

recovery phrase for fajeg-hagug: holox-fenmir

### Container image slimming

Quick note before you review anything in the Fernwhistle deploy repo: we care a lot about image size. Base images come from our curated `slimcore` set, build tools must live in a separate builder stage, and anything that adds more than ~20MB needs a comment explaining why. When reviewing, check for stray apt caches and dev dependencies sneaking into the final layer. The slimming checklist we expect reviewers to apply, plus approved base images, is kept on this page.

wiki page, bagaf-fawip: https://harbor.tolvaqsys.local/pages/repo/pages/secrets/eac969ffc71f356b